WARNING: I had the battery bulge issue causing trackpad dysfunction, but all else was pristine on my 17” MB Pro. I followed these steps to a “T” to replace the battery. However one step they don’t tell you is the key command to “power down” the battery first. Apparently, even though nothing seemed to go wrong at all during the process, a surge from power leftover when I disconnected the old and/or reconnected the new battery went thru the logic board to the display, and the display was toast and I had to pay $400 for a new display that was working perfectly without a single glitch before I opened it up to replace the bulging battery. An Apple expert told me of this and although it is not common, it can happen and should always be included as a step BEFORE removing these internal batteries with stickers that read DO NOT REMOVE THE BATTERY! Apple does not tell you this because they don’t want you to replace it yourself (unlike the external latch-type battery on the very first 2008 unibodies).
